Shanks' daughter is a character introduced in the film One Piece Film: Red. She is not part of the original manga or anime series, which often leads to debates about her canonical status. In the movie, her name is Uta and she plays a pivotal role in the story. Fans should note that this character is specifically created for the film and her story might not align with the larger One Piece universe.
